Overview of silicon boride SiB6 powder

Silicon boride (silicon hexaboride) is a shiny black-gray powder with a relative density of 3.0g/cm3 and a melting point of 2200°C. Silicon boride is a lightweight ceramic compound formed between silicon and boron. It is insoluble in water, resistant to oxidation, thermal shock and chemical attack, and has high strength and stability especially under thermal shock. The grinding efficiency is higher than that of boron carbide.

The SiB6 crystal structure includes interconnected icosahedrons (polyhedrons with 20 faces), icosahedral hexahedrons (polyhedrons with 26 faces), and isolated silicon and boron atoms. Compared with hexaboride, it is metastable. However, since crystal nucleation and growth are relatively easy, they can be prepared.

When heated in air or oxygen, the surface of SiB6 is oxidized and corroded by boiling sulfuric acid and fluorine, chlorine and bromine at high temperatures. Silicon boride is conductive. The coefficient of thermal expansion of hexaborides is low, and the nuclear cross section of thermal neutrons is large.

How is silicon boride SiB6 produced? A method for preparing silicon boride powder is as follows

A ceramic ball mill is used to uniformly mix silicon powder with an average particle size of less than 1 micron and boron powder with an average particle size of less than 20 microns. The weight ratio of silicon powder and boron powder is 2.85-2.95:7.

After being put into the crucible, put it in a gas protection furnace, pass in argon gas, and heat to 1400-160°C for 50-70 minutes;

At the beginning of the heat preservation, put ASiCl4 into the furnace, 3-5 ml per minute, dripping time 9-11 minutes;

After cooling, the final SIB6 powder product obtained by pulverizing with a ceramic pot ball mill.

Application of silicon boride SIB6 powder

1. Used as various standard abrasives and grinding cemented carbides;

2. Used as engineering ceramic material, used as various standard abrasives, and grind cemented carbide.

3. It can also be used as engineering ceramic materials, sandblasting nozzles, manufacturing blades of gas engines and other special-shaped sintered parts and seals.

4. Used as an antioxidant for refractory materials. Silicon boride SiB6 powder.
